- What is Ducommun's electronic systems — capex?
- Ducommun (DCO) reported electronic systems — capex of $886K in Q1 2026.
- How has Ducommun's electronic systems — capex changed year-over-year?
- Ducommun's electronic systems — capex decreased by 60.9% year-over-year, from $2.27M to $886K.
- What is the long-term trend for Ducommun's electronic systems — capex?
- Over 4 years (2021 to 2025), Ducommun's electronic systems — capex has grown at a -5.4%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$7.47M to $5.98M.
- What does electronic systems — capex mean?
- Represents the cash outflows used by the Electronic Systems segment to acquire, upgrade, and maintain physical assets such as property, plants, and equipment. This metric reflects the segment's investment in long-term operational capacity and technological infrastructure required to support high-performance manufacturing.
